International Obligations Governing Satellite Operators

International obligations governing satellite operators are rooted in numerous multilateral treaties and agreements that establish global standards. Key among these is the Convention on Registration of Objects Launched into Outer Space, which mandates registration of satellite entities with the United Nations. This ensures transparency and accountability on an international level.

Satellite operators also adhere to principles set by the International Telecommunication Union (ITU), which regulates spectrum allocation and orbital slot assignments. These regulations prevent harmful interference and promote orderly management of space resources. Compliance with ITU standards is mandatory for international authorization, emphasizing the importance of global cooperation.

Moreover, satellite operators must respect international laws concerning space debris mitigation. Initiatives such as the Space Debris Mitigation Guidelines aim to minimize space junk and its potential hazards. Failure to follow these obligations can result in sanctions, liability issues, or loss of operating licenses under international law.

Overall, adherence to international obligations ensures responsible satellite operation and fosters sustainable use of outer space, aligning national policies with global legal standards.

Responsibilities for Space Debris Mitigation

Responsible satellite operators must adhere to international guidelines and best practices regarding space debris mitigation. This includes designing satellites with passivation measures to prevent accidental explosions and reducing long-term contamination of orbital environments.

Operators are expected to minimize debris creation during satellite launch, operation, and decommissioning phases. Proper end-of-life procedures, such as deorbiting or moving satellites to designated graveyard orbits, are essential for space debris mitigation efforts.

Compliance with space debris mitigation guidelines is vital, as orbital congestion can threaten satellite safety and sustainable use of space. International organizations, like the United Nations Office for Outer Space Affairs (UNOOSA), emphasize the importance of proactive debris mitigation by satellite operators across nations.

Compliance with National and International Export Controls

Compliance with national and international export controls is a fundamental legal responsibility of satellite operators to prevent the unauthorized transfer of sensitive technology. It ensures that satellite technology and related components do not fall into the wrong hands or violate security policies.

Satellite operators must adhere to export regulations such as the U.S. International Traffic in Arms Regulations (ITAR) and the Export Administration Regulations (EAR), along with relevant international treaties. Key requirements include:

  1. Obtaining necessary export licenses before sharing satellite technology or data across borders.
  2. Conducting thorough due diligence to identify restricted end-users or destinations.
  3. Maintaining detailed records of all export transactions for compliance verification.
  4. Regularly updating compliance procedures to align with evolving regulations.

Failure to comply can result in severe penalties, including fines, sanctions, and loss of operating licenses. Moreover, adherence to export controls fosters international cooperation and safeguards national security interests.
